Something new:

"Retournement de situation : Le journal suisse qui annonçait le nouvel album d'Alizée dans son édition du 24 septembre nous annonce aujourd'hui par mail que l'article en question est une "malencontreuse erreur"... En clair, la personne qui a rédigé cet article n'a pas cru bon de se renseigner avant. Un rectificatif sera normalement publié dans la prochaine édition.
A bon entendeur : toute la communauté de fans attend espère fortement des excuses de la part du journal..."


Translation (by Google)


"Turnaround situation: The Swiss newspaper which announced the new album from Alizée in its edition of September 24 announced today by mail that the article in question was an "unfortunate mistake" ... Clearly, the person who wrote this article has not seen fit to learn before. A corrigendum will normally be published in the next edition.
A good entendeur: the whole community of fans awaiting strongly hopes apology from the newspaper ..."
